Samsung Acquires Oxford Semantic Technologies to Enhance AI Capabilities
The acquisition aims to integrate advanced knowledge graph technology into Samsung's devices for improved personalization.
- Samsung announced the acquisition of UK-based Oxford Semantic Technologies to boost its AI capabilities.
- Oxford Semantic Technologies specializes in knowledge graphs, enhancing data processing and personalized user experiences.
- The technology will be applied across Samsung's mobile devices, TVs, and home appliances.
- Samsung has collaborated with Oxford Semantic since 2018 and has invested in its development.
- The acquisition reflects Samsung's strategy to advance AI in its products, including the Bixby virtual assistant.
